Buffers, Drivers, Receivers, Transceivers onsemi 74VCXH245WM Overview
The Buffers, Drivers, Receivers, Transceivers onsemi 74VCXH245WM is an advanced, high-speed CMOS transceiver designed for use in communication and computing environments where low power consumption and high data integrity are paramount. This transceiver operates on a 3.6V power supply, making it ideal for portable and low-power applications. Its ability to handle bidirectional data makes it versatile and essential for interfacing data buses. With a robust 20-SOIC package, the 74VCXH245WM ensures reliable connectivity and long-term performance in demanding applications.
74VCXH245WM Features
This IC features non-inverting bus transceiver circuits with 3-state outputs, providing a direct interface to a wide range of voltages while maintaining speed and signal integrity. The device supports bus hold on data inputs, eliminating the need for external pull-up resistors and reducing system cost and complexity. Enhanced ESD protection and low-voltage operation complement its design, suited for battery-operated devices.
